Roping in Erich as the attributes code owner. In general, I think this is going 
in roughly the right direction. One concern I have is that the distinction 
between a keyword spelling for an attribute is now a bit harder. We have 
keyword attributes and we have attribute-like keywords, and it's hard to know 
when it's appropriate to use one over another. From what I can tell, it seems 
that the biggest distinction between the two is automatic parsing or not and 
diagnostic wording (please correct me if I'm missing something!). If I'm 
correct, then I don't think we want an additional attribute syntax enumeration 
for this (it's still `AS_Keyword`), but we should surface this via 
Attr.td/tablegen so that the `Keyword` spelling can opt into the extra 
generality (or perhaps we want the default to be all keyword attributes get the 
general behavior and we make a few existing attributes opt out).
